"This East Riverside Mexican restaurant is highly underrated despite making superb breakfast and lunch tacos. A pro move would be to order the barbacoa and add diced potatoes and refried beans; you won’t regret it. This spot has a fast-casual vibe, with colorfully painted furniture and a very nice covered patio. Takeout orders can be placed online or in person." - Nadia Chaudhury

"I’m in the middle of slowly working my way through revisiting and visiting taco trucks and restaurants around the city to eventually update the taco map (it’s been wonderful). A recent revisit was to our favorite go-to taco spot Taco Joint on East Riverside. I decided to shake things up by adding potatoes (I have done this before to wonderful results) and refried beans to my barbacoa taco, and, yeah, this is going to become a new staple taco for me. The diced potatoes play well with the juicy barbacoa and the refried beans added a nice bit of salt and texture. Pair with copious amounts of salsa, and enjoy." - Eater Staff
